I am so fed-up with ASUS! To pay R10,000 for an i7, 8 GB RAM, 1 TB Harddisk computer - and then - when you discover the massive short-cuts they have taken on essential things like status LED's, and an POWER ON/OFF button where the "End" key should be - and then "to make the computer affordable" they totally removed the "End" key!!!
And when I inquired about this, ASUS merely states "It is an 'entry level' computer for 'general office use'..."!!!
What do you use an office computer for? Word Processing? Yes, Definitely!! But don't use the "End" key to get to the end of the paragraph, as your computer will shut down immediately!
And oh my! Don't even consider an ASUS Laptop if you're into typing Afrikaans on the social media, because with the lack of an LED to indicate the status of the "Caps Lock" key and the "Num Lock" key, you will lose hours and hours of typed information when you try and key in any of the ALT-Codes, because your social media tab will instantly turn into a "New Tab" if your "Num Lock" key got tapped along the way somewhere - and you have not the slightest idea as to the status of it - and your Numbers keypad becomes cursor control keys without ANY indication or warning...!
So I just lost about an hour's worth of typing, and when I wanted to enter my "Copyright Mark - Alt-0169 (©) right at the end, my Web Explorer just closed the tab, and presented an empty new tab!
How frustrating! And all just because ASUS wanted to save a few cents on status LED's!
